
F55 Bus Route Dubai Overview
The F55 is a feeder bus service that connects Expo 2020 Metro Station with Al Maktoum International Airport (DWC / PTB). It is mainly used by passengers traveling between the Dubai Metro Red Line and the airport area, especially for access to Dubai World Central, Emaar South, and the surrounding airport districts.
This route is a practical option for budget-friendly airport travel because it links the metro with the airport and nearby business zones. Depending on the source, the route is described as serving Zone 1, with a journey of about 40–45 minutes and a total road distance of around 20 km.

F55 Bus 13 Stops
The route below combines the common stop pattern from the competitor pages and keeps the full 13-stop structure.
- Expo 2020 Metro Station
- Dubai World Central, Headquarter Entrance
- Dubai World Central, Headquarters
- Dubai World Central, Offices Park
- Dubai World Central, PFF Group
- Dubai World Central, Freight House
- Dubai World Central, Cargo Terminal A
- Dubai World Central, Gate 6
- Emaar South Entrance 1
- Emaar South Entrance 2
- Aerospace Supply Chain Zone
- Al Maktoum Airport, Departure Area
- Al Maktoum Airport, Arrivals Area

Frequency and Journey Time
The f55 bus usually runs at different intervals depending on the time of day.
- Peak hours: every 12 to 30 minutes.
- Off-peak hours: every 20 to 60 minutes.
- Morning peak: around 7:00 AM to 9:00 AM.
- Evening peak: around 5:00 PM to 8:00 PM.
The trip generally takes about 40 to 45 minutes, though some sources mention a shorter estimate of around 32 minutes for a faster version of the route.
